Today was a nice and sunny day in Borovets, with 5-10 cm of fresh snow overnight in the Markudjik ski center. Temperatures were mostly below 0°C in the early morning but rose later in the day to 5-10°C, depending on how high up in the ski resort you were. Wind conditions were very stable, with only a slight breeze up in the Markudjik Ski Center, which was a nice change to the windy conditions we had at the end of February and beginning of March. During the weekend we’re expecting similar conditions with plenty of sun and good times!

All lifts in the resort are working, even the Markudjik 3 surface lift, which was closed for most of the season. Lift lines were again nowhere to be found except at the gondola station. There the queue was about 10-15 minutes, even though the line was all the way outside of the building. It only looks like it will take much longer than it actually does. We literally didn’t wait in line on any chairlift today, at all. Perfect!

Up in the Markudjik Ski Center, we got around 10cm of new snow and threw down some powder turns around the Markudjik 3 ski piste. Conditions on the slopes were much better here than in the lower ski centers thanks to the fresh snow. Don’t be afraid of a little rain though from now until the end of the season, as there is plenty of snow to last until April at the least. Conditions were worst today in the Yastrebets Ski Center, as the slopes were much icier than normal and it’s been like this for a while now. This is due to the warm temperatures during the day melting the top layer of snow and it then freezing overnight. The slopes do loosen up in the afternoon, but you should be careful nonetheless.

In the Sitnyakovo Ski Center, the slopes are again icy in the morning but soften up much earlier than in the Yastrebets Ski Center. By noon, the flat parts of the slopes are a little slushy, while the steeper Martinovi Baraki runs remain hard. The snow park is currently closed due to various kids races. Today was the boardercross race and tomorrow there will be a freestyle competition. We have no information when the park will be again open to the public, but our guess is Monday, once the races are over.
